Food Inclusions Market Report Scope & Overview:

The Food Inclusions Market Size is valued at USD 14.33 Billion in 2025E and is projected to reach USD 22.47 Bill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 5.81% during the forecast period 2026–2033.

The Food Inclusions Market analysis report provides a comprehensive overview of industry trends, highlighting rising demand for product customization, texture and flavor enhancement and premium bakery and confectionery applications. Increasing consumption of processed foods and innovation in clean-label and functional ingredients are expected to drive market growth during the forecast period.

Food Inclusions consumption exceeded 9.2 million metric tons in 2025, driven by rising bakery, confectionery and dairy production and growing demand for value-added processed foods.

Food Inclusions Market Restraints:

  • Fluctuating raw material prices and complex formulation requirements limit consistent growth in the food inclusions market.

Fluctuating raw material prices and complex formulation requirements present notable restraints for the Food Inclusions Market. Key inputs such as nuts, cocoa, fruits and cereals are vulnerable to climate variability, supply disruptions and price swings. Additionally, ensuring consistency in taste, texture and visual quality across batches increases formulation complexity and production costs. These challenges limit scalability, pressure manufacturer margins and create entry barriers for smaller players seeking to compete in premium and customized food inclusion segments.

By Type, Fruits & Nuts Dominates While Chocolate Expands Rapidly:

Fruits & Nuts segment dominated the market due to its widespread use across bakery, confectionery and dairy products. Its natural flavor, nutritional value and versatility make it a preferred choice for premium and value-added products. In 2025, consumption of fruits & nuts inclusions surpassed 3.1 million metric tons, reflecting strong adoption.

Chocolate is the fastest-growing segment, is gaining popularity for indulgent bakery, confectionery and snack applications. Rising demand for decadent flavors, gifting products and customized chocolate inclusions is driving its rapid growth. In 2025, chocolate inclusions consumption reached 1.2 million metric tons, demonstrating increasing consumer preference.

By Form, Solid Dominates While Semi-Solid Expands Rapidly:

Solid segment dominated the market due to ease of handling, long shelf-life and broad application in bakery, confectionery and snack products. Its versatility in enhancing texture and visual appeal makes it a staple for large-scale manufacturers. In 2025, solid inclusions consumption exceeded 5.2 million metric tons.

Semi-Solid is the fastest-growing segment, driven by demand for spreads, fillings and ready-to-eat foods that require pliable, creamy or gel-based inclusions. Rising adoption in dairy desserts and innovative bakery products has spurred its growth. In 2025, semi-solid inclusions consumption reached 1.1 million metric tons, highlighting rapid market expansion.

By Functionality, Texture Enhancement Dominates While Nutritional Fortification Expands Rapidly:

Texture Enhancement segment dominated the market due to food manufacturers are focusing on providing consumers with improved mouthfeel, crunchiness and sensory appeal. It is widely applied in bakery, confectionery, snacks and dairy products to enhance product differentiation. In 2025, texture-enhancing inclusions accounted for over 2.8 million metric tons.

Nutritional Fortification is the fastest-growing segment, is driven by rising consumer awareness of health, protein enrichment and fiber-fortified products. Manufacturers are incorporating seeds, nuts and cereal inclusions to meet this demand. In 2025, fortified inclusions consumption reached 950,000 metric tons, reflecting strong growth potential.

By Application, Bakery Dominates While Dairy & Frozen Desserts Expands Rapidly:

Bakery segment dominated the market due to its high consumption of inclusions such as nuts, chocolate and fruits to enhance flavor, texture and visual appeal. Large-scale production of cakes, pastries and bread ensures consistent demand. In 2025, bakery applications consumed 3.5 million metric tons of inclusions.

Dairy & Frozen Desserts is the fastest-growing segment, propelled by consumer preference for premium ice creams, yogurt toppings and functional frozen desserts. Manufacturers are innovating with unique mix-ins and flavors. In 2025, this segment used 1.05 million metric tons, highlighting its rapid adoption.

By Distribution Channel, Retail Dominates While Foodservice Expands Rapidly:

Retail segment dominated the market as supermarkets, hypermarkets and specialty stores provide easy access to inclusions for home baking and everyday consumption. The availability of packaged and ready-to-use inclusions drives consumer adoption. In 2025, retail channels accounted for over 6.2 million metric tons of food inclusions sales.

Foodservice is the fastest-growing segment, benefits from increasing demand in cafes, restaurants and bakery chains that incorporate inclusions into desserts, snacks and beverages. In 2025, foodservice channels consumed 2.15 million metric tons, reflecting rapid growth due to menu innovation and premium offerings.

Food Inclusions Market Competitive Landscape:

Barry Callebaut AG, headquartered in Zürich, Switzerland, is a leader in chocolate and cocoa-based food inclusions. The company dominates the market through its fully integrated supply chain, from sourcing high-quality cocoa beans to producing tailored chocolate and inclusions for bakery, confectionery and dairy applications. Barry Callebaut invests heavily in R&D, offering innovative, sustainable and functional products such as nut-filled chocolates, flavored inclusions and texturizing solutions. Its presence, partnerships with leading food brands and commitment to quality and sustainability reinforce its market-leading position.

  • In November 2025, Barry Callebaut partnered with NotCo AI to develop AI-driven chocolate innovations, creating tailored inclusions with improved texture, flavor and sustainability for bakery, confectionery and dairy applications across markets.

Olam International, headquartered in Singapore, is a leading supplier of nuts, cocoa and other food inclusions across markets. The company dominates through a vertically integrated model, controlling sourcing, processing and distribution, ensuring consistent quality and traceability. Its wide portfolio includes almonds, hazelnuts, cocoa and specialty inclusions tailored for bakery, confectionery and dairy products. Olam leverages sustainable sourcing initiatives, advanced R&D and strategic partnerships with manufacturers, enabling innovation in clean-label, plant-based and functional inclusions that meet evolving consumer demands.

  • In February 2025, Olam Food Ingredients launched a new range of plant-based, functional inclusion blends featuring sustainable nuts, cocoa and cereals for bakery, confectionery and dairy, enhancing texture, flavor and nutritional appeal.

Nestlé S.A., headquartered in Vevey, Switzerland, is a dominant player in the food and beverage industry, including food inclusions for bakery, confectionery and dairy applications. The company’s strong market presence is supported by a vast product portfolio, advanced R&D and a focus on quality, safety and nutritional enhancement. Nestlé develops innovative inclusions such as chocolate chips, nuts and cereals, catering to premium, clean-label and functional products. Strategic acquisitions, distribution networks and consumer-focused innovation have solidified Nestlé’s leadership in the inclusions market.

  • In August 2025, Nestlé launched a bakery-inspired confectionery range in the UK, featuring new textures and hybrid flavors such as Aero Double Choc Brownie, Milkybar Crispy Cookie and Munchies Vanilla Cheesecake with cookie and biscuit inclusions.
